DescriptionDoll wearing the school uniform of St Mary's Lower School and carrying a satchel. The doll was presented to Mrs Mary Perrins by the school when she retired as Deputy Headmistress in 1996. The uniform was made in 1996 by Mrs Sykes, a parent of pupils at the school.doll: plastic doll & blue eyes with eyelids that blink & blond nylon hair tied back with a ribbon and a fringeuniform: navy blue felt hat with blue and white petersham ribbon and a turned up rim & navy blue and white striped scarf & navy polyester double breasted hooded duffel coat with a green and blue tartan lining and six blue plastic buttons & navy polyester woollen cardigan with three plastic blue buttons & navy synthetic pinafore with a front zip & white cotton polyester shirt & blue synthetic tie with small silver stripes & navy cotton pants & white cotton vest & pair of navy polyester socks & black plastic shoes with Cinderella No. 5 written on the bottomsatchel: brown leather & buckle fastening & containing a miniature pack of 12 wax crayons, three small plastic 'stackable' crayons, a miniature notebook saying 'Happy Thoughts' on the cover, a miniature watercolour set and a miniature brown notebook and pencil set.
